1// Like the compiler, the static analyzer treats some functions differently if
2// they come from a system header -- for example, it is assumed that system
3// functions do not arbitrarily free() their parameters, and that some bugs
4// found in system headers cannot be fixed by the user and should be
5// suppressed.
6#pragma clang system_header
7
8typedef __typeof(sizeof(int)) size_t;
9void *malloc(size_t);
10void *calloc(size_t, size_t);
11void free(void *);
